In 29 gadolinium-enhanced breast magnetic resonance (MR) examinations, breast motion prevented accurate and efficient image processing. To compensate for global rotations and translations, an automatic motion correction method with a ratio-variance minimization algorithm was used to align images at multiple time points through an iterative process. This method reduced breast motion and improved the accuracy and efficiency of lesion detection.
